2018 Senate Bill 1261 / Public Act 485

Accomodate elected officials in military

Introduced in the Senate

Dec. 5, 2018

Introduced by Sen. Adam Hollier (D-2)

To require public bodies to establish procedures to accommodate the absence of any member due to military duty.

Referred to the Committee on Elections and Government Reform

Dec. 6, 2018

Reported without amendment

With the recommendation that the bill pass.

Dec. 13, 2018

Amendment offered

To exempt the legislature.

The amendment passed by voice vote

Passed in the Senate 33 to 4 (details)

To require public bodies to establish procedures to accommodate the absence of any member due to military duty; the legislature would be exempt, however.

Received in the House

Dec. 18, 2018

Dec. 21, 2018

Passed in the House 73 to 36 (details)

Signed by Gov. Rick Snyder

Dec. 26, 2018
